Fans are excited to play the remastered version but probably have some questions. Such as, what is the Monster Hunter Stories Switch Remaster Release Date?

The Monster Hunter Stories Switch Remaster Release Date will be on June 14, 2024.
This should not be a big surprise as it was announced that the second game, Monster Hunter Stories 2: Wings of Ruin would be coming with it. This is a full remaster of the original game which was released back in 2017. Fans are currently able to pre order the game as well.

It will be out as the title suggests on the Nintendo Switch but also on PlayStation 4 and Steam. That means that it will be on PC but not on Game Pass. There is a chance that in the future it could make its way to Game Pass since the PC port will exist. But for now, it is likely going to remain on the two consoles from Japan and computers.
The Monster Hunter Stories Remaster gameplay will be very similar to how it was upon its initial release. You will go around getting your monsties and trying to get the stronger ones. You are a rider and the goal is to get them all.
Battling will be the same where it goes into turn-based battles once you run into the fight. This will see you as the rider attacking and your monstie doing their attacks at your command as well. Sounds familiar right? This game is very similar to Pokemon so Pokemon fans should expect to enjoy this one, especially if they like the Monster Hunter franchise as well.
